ObjectiveTo determine the effect of intravenous ketamine on the minimum alveolar concentration of sevoflurane needed to block autonomic response (MACBAR) to a noxious stimulus in dogs.Study designRandomized, crossover, prospective design.AnimalsEight, healthy, adult male, mixed-breed dogs, weighing 11.2–16.1 kg.MethodsDogs were anesthetized with sevoflurane on two occasions, 1 week apart, and baseline MACBAR (B-MACBAR) was determined on each occasion. MACBAR was defined as the mean of the end-tidal sevoflurane concentrations that prevented and allowed an increase (≥15%) in heart rate or invasive mean arterial pressure in response to a noxious electrical stimulus (50 V, 50 Hz, 10 ms). Dogs then randomly received either a low-dose (LDS) or high-dose series (HDS) of ketamine, and treatment MACBAR (T-MACBAR) was determined. The LDS had an initial loading dose (LD) of 0.5 mg kg?1 and constant rate infusion (CRI) at 6.25 μg kg?1 minute?1, followed, after T-MACBAR determination, by a second LD (1 mg kg?1) and CRI (12.5 μg kg?1 minute?1). The HDS had an initial LD (2 mg kg?1) and CRI (25 μg kg?1 minute?1) followed by a second LD (3 mg kg?1) and CRI (50 μg kg?1 minute?1). Data were analyzed with a mixed-model anova and are presented as LSM ± SEM.ResultsThe B-MACBAR was not significantly different between treatments. Ketamine at 12.5, 25, and 50 μg kg?1 minute?1 decreased sevoflurane MACBAR, and the maximal decrease (22%) occurred at 12.5 μg kg?1 minute?1. The percentage change in MACBAR was not correlated with either the log plasma ketamine or norketamine concentration.Conclusions and clinical relevanceKetamine at clinically relevant doses of 12.5, 25, and 50 μg kg?1 minute?1 decreased sevoflurane MACBAR, although the reduction was neither dose-dependent nor linear. 相似文献

Seeds from four pairs of tomato isogenic/near-isogenic lines (IL/NIL) differing for anthocyaninless of Hoffmann (ah), three
pairs of IL/NILs differing for anthocyaninwithout (aw) and six pairs of IL/NILs differing for baby lea syndrome (bls) were
evaluated for their germination ability under stress conditions: low and high temperature, salt and osmotic stress. Mutant
genes affecting anthocyanin biosynthesis enhanced tomato germination capacity under all above mentioned treatments, except
for the aw gene under a PEG-6000 treatment. Testa removal accelerated germination under stress conditions, but differences
in time to 50% germination between the wild type lines and their ah-, aw- and bls-IL/NILs although diminished, were not eliminated.

The effect of three mutant genes affecting anthocyanin biosynthesis – anthocyaninless of Hoffmann (ah), anthocyaninwithout
(aw) and baby lea syndrome (bls) – on tomato germination capacities at 24 ° C was investigated. The study was performed on
nine anthocyanin containing lines – Apedice, Apeca, Ailsa Craig, Monfavet 167, Monfavet 168, Por, Piernita, VF 36 and VFNT
cherry and 13 isogenic/near isogenic lines (IL/NIL) from them: 4 differing for gene ah, 3 differing for gene aw and 6 differing
for gene bls). In the majority of the anthocyaninless IL/NILs germination began earlier than that in the wild type lines.
Significant differences were observed in the time to 50% germination between the anthocyanin-containing and the anthocyaninless
IL/NILs except for the most rapidly germinating line VFNT cherry. Seed weight, water uptake, effect of testa removal and presence
or absence of maternal effects in F1 germination responses were investigated in order to elucidate the causes of the more
rapid germination in the anthocyaninless IL/NILs. The increased amount of water uptake by the anthocyaninless lines, the shorter
treatment time necessary for their testa removal, the important maternal effects in the genetic variability of the time to
50% germination and the differences in germination capacities between the wild type and the mutant IL/NILs after testa removal,
indicated that the seed coat and the endosperm had to be affected by the effects of the three genes in a way that caused enhanced
germination.

OBJECTIVE: It is hypothesised that mothers' social networks can positively affect child nutrition through the sharing of health knowledge and other resources. The present study describes the composition of mothers' networks, examines their association with child nutrition, and assesses whether health knowledge is shared within networks. DESIGN AND SETTING: Cross-sectional data for mothers of young children from Andhra Pradesh (south India) were combined with existing data from the Young Lives study, in which the mothers were participating (n = 282). RESULTS: The composition of social networks varied between urban and rural areas, with urban networks being larger, more female, more literate and with a greater proportion of members living outside the household and being non-family. There was a positive association between child's height-for-age Z-score and mother's network size and network literacy rate. The association with network literacy was stronger among the poorest households. Women commonly reported seeking or receiving health advice from network members.CONCLUSION: Big and literate social networks are associated with better child nutrition, especially among the poor. The dissemination of health knowledge between network members is a plausible way in which social networks benefit child nutrition in India. Further research into the underlying mechanisms is necessary to inform the development of interventions that channel health information through word of mouth to the most excluded and vulnerable families. 相似文献

The growth in organic and local foods consumption has been examined using two different approaches to identify characteristics and motivations of food shoppers: market segmentation and economic models using multivariate analysis. The former approach, based on Means-end Chain theory, examines how intrinsic characteristics of foods affect food choices. The latter microeconomic approach examines economic constraints and extrinsic factors. This study demonstrates value in combining the two approaches to generate better empirical predictions of who buys organic and local food. It also supports a broader theoretical framework to explain behavior in terms of intrinsic and extrinsic motivations. Using US data, an adaptation of the Food Related Lifestyle model yields four consumer lifestyles segmented by intrinsic motivations related to food. Each consumer segment exhibits distinct organic and local foods consumption behaviors. A multinomial logit model is estimated to examine the probability of being in one of these four groups as a function of extrinsic variables and economic constraints. In support of Alphabet theory and Regulatory Focus theory, we find that inclusion of extrinsic factors improves prediction of behavior and the ability to explain why they buy organic and local foods. The extrinsic variables that significantly increase the probability of being in a particular consumer food lifestyle segment include: environmental concerns, health practices, race, the presence of a farmers’ market, and to a lesser degree, family composition and income. We also find regulatory focus is most pronounced among the most active organic and local food shoppers. 相似文献

Three isomers of the ligand 2,5-bis(pyridinyl)-1,3,4-thiadiazole, with the N atom of pyridine group in position 2, 3 or 4, named respectively, L2, L3 and L4 were compared for their use as plant defense activators. They were examined for their ability to protect tomato plants from Verticillium dahliae and Agrobacterium tumefaciens in the greenhouse, to induce reactive oxygen species and to activate plant defenses, including antioxidant enzymes. The three ligand isomers exhibited in vitro only slight inhibition of radial growth of V. dahliae, while no significant inhibition was observed for phytopathogenic bacteria. In the greenhouse, the three ligand isomers statistically reduced the severity of Verticillium wilt and crown gall on tomato plants, and the isomers L3 and L4 were the most efficient to control Verticillium wilt. This superiority was reflected in their differential ability to activate H2O2 accumulation, antioxidant enzymes including catalase and ascorbate peroxidase and other defense-related enzymes such as guaiacol peroxidase and polyphenol oxidase. These results demonstrated that the presence of the N atom within the two pyridinyl groups in the position 3 or 4 highly enhanced the activity of plant defense and antioxidant responses as well as their ability to reduce the severity of symptoms caused by V. dahliae on tomato. 相似文献

This is a community based research project using a case study of 20 people living in middle America who are food insecure, but do not use food pantries. The participants’ rate of actual hunger is twice that of food insecure community members who use food pantries. Since most of the participants are not poor, the Asset Vulnerability Framework (AVF) is used to classify causes of food insecurity. The purpose of the study is to identify why participants are food insecure and why they do not use food pantries. Findings reveal that the participants restrict the quality and quantity of food eaten as a strategy to manage their budget. Following AVF, this strategy allows them to offset lower returns to labor assets, cover rising costs of human capital investment, protect their two most important productive assets of housing and transportation, and compensate for household relationships that increase their vulnerability. In addition, food insecurity itself inhibited social capital formation, further increasing vulnerability. The main reasons the participants do not use food pantries is to protect their social capital assets: almost all of the participants hid their hunger from colleagues, friends, relatives, and even the people they lived with. The participants described fear of societal shaming and blaming as motivations for hiding their hunger. However, using food pantries could reduce their food insecurity. Therefore, there was a feedback loop between food insecurity and social capital: food insecurity reduced social capital and efforts to protect social capital prevented participants from improving food security by using food pantries. 相似文献

This is the story of Slow Food University of Wisconsin (SFUW), a student organization that grew from one woman’s idea to a community of over 3200 people dedicated to making sustainable, fairly produced, delicious food accessible in a small city, with a big university, in the heart of the United States. Along the way SFUW has fostered new ideas, developed skills, and built relationships through conscious food procurement, cooking and eating. This essay describes the evolution of the organization and its four projects: Family Dinner Night, South Madison, Outreach and the Café. It hasn’t always been easy, but it’s always been delicious. 相似文献

This retrospective study was designed to assess the effect of pimobendan on the median survival time (MST) of cats with non-taurine responsive dilated cardiomyopathy (DCM). Thirty-two client-owned cats with a left ventricular internal dimension at end systole (LVIDs) >14 mm, a fractional shortening (FS) <28% and a lack of response to taurine therapy were included over a 9-year period (2001-2010). These cats were divided into pimobendan (n=16) and non-pimobendan (n=16) treatment groups. All cats received standard treatment with frusemide, taurine and benazepril or enalapril. Nine cats in the non-pimobendan group also received digoxin. The MST of the pimobendan group (49 days; range 1 to >502 days) was four times that of the non-pimobendan group (12 days; 1 to 244 days). The difference in survival between the two groups was statistically significant (P = 0.048). Hypothermia and FS <20% were associated with a poor prognosis. No adverse effects to pimobendan were noted. 相似文献
